hwæt ic þysne sang siþgeomor fand on seocum sefan samnode wide hu þa æþelingas ellen cyþdon torhte ond tireadige twelfe wæron dædum domfæste dryhtne gecorene leofe on life lof wide sprang miht ond mærþo ofer middangeard þeodnes þegna þrym unlytel halgan heape hlyt wisode þær hie dryhtnes æ deman sceoldon reccan fore rincum sume on romebyrig frame fyrdhwate feorh ofgefon þurg nerones nearwe searwe petrus ond paulus is se apostolhad wide geweorþod ofer werþeoda swylce andreas in achagia for egias aldre geneþde ne þreodode he fore þrymme þeodcyninges æniges on eorþan ac him ece geceas langsumre lif leoht unhwilen syþþan hildeheard heriges byrhtme æfter guþplegan gealgan þehte hwæt we eac gehyrdon be iohanne æglæawe menn æþelo reccan se manna wæs mine gefrege þurh cneorisse criste leofast on weres hade syþþan wuldres cyning engla ordfruma eorþan sohte þurh fæmnan hrif fæder manncynnes he in effessia ealle þrage leode lærde þanon lifes weg siþe gesohte swegle dreamas beorhtne boldwelan næs his broþor læt siþes sæne ac þurh sweordes bite mid iudeum iacob sceolde fore herode ealdre gedælan feorh wiþ flæsce philipus wæs mid asseum þanon ece lif þurh rode cwealm ricene gesohte syþþan on galgan in gearapolim ahangen wæs hildecorþre huru wide wearþ wurd undyrne þæt to indeum aldre gelædde beaducræftig beorn bartholameus þone heht astrias in albano hæþen ond hygeblind heafde beneotan forþan he þa hæþengild hyran ne wolde wig weorþian him wæs wuldres dream lifwela leofra þonne þas leasan godu swylce thomas eac þriste geneþde on indea oþre dælas þær manegum wearþ mod onlihted hige onhyrded þurh his halig word syþþan collenferþ cyninges broþor awehte for weorodum wundorcræfte þurh dryhtnes miht þæt he of deaþe aras geong ond guþhwæt ond him wæs gad nama ond þa þæm folce feorg gesealde sin æt sæcce sweordræs fornam þurh hæþene hand þær se halga gecrang wund for weorudum þonon wuldres leoht sawle gesohte sigores to leane hwæt we þæt gehyrdon þurg halige bec þæt mid sigelwarum soþ yppe wearþ dryhtlic dom godes dæges or onwoc leohtes geleafan land wæs gefælsod þurh matheus mære lare þone het irtacus þurh yrne hyge wælreow cyning wæpnum aswebban hyrde we þæt iacob in ierusalem fore sacerdum swilt þrowode þurg stenges sweng stiþmod gecrang eadig for æfestum hafaþ nu ece lif mid wuldorcining wiges to leane næron þa twegen tohtan sæne lindgelaces land persea sohton siþfrome simon ond thaddeus beornas beadorofe him wearþ bam samod an endedæg æþele sceoldon þurh wæpenhete weorc þrowigan sigelean secan ond þone soþan gefean dream æfter deaþe þa gedæled wearþ lif wiþ lice ond þas lænan gestreon idle æhtwelan ealle forhogodan þus þa æþelingas ende gesealdon twelf tilmodige tir unbræcne wegan on gewitte wuldres þegnas nu ic þonne bidde beorn se þe lufige þysses giddes begang þæt he geomrum me þone halgan heap helpe bidde friþes ond fultomes hu ic freonda beþearf liþra on lade þonne ic sceal langne ham eardwic uncuþ ana gesecan lætan me on laste lic eorþan dæl wælreaf wunigean weormum to hroþre her mæg findan foreþances gleaw se þe hine lysteþ leoþgiddunga hwa þas fitte fegde feoh þær on ende standeþ eorlas þæs on eorþan brucaþ ne moton hie awa ætsomne woruldwunigende wyn sceal gedreosan ur on eþle æfter tohreosan læne lices frætewa efne swa lagu toglideþ þonne cen ond yr cræftes neosaþ nihtes nearowe on him nied ligeþ cyninges þeodom nu þu cunnon miht hwa on þam wordum wæs werum oncyþig sie þæs gemyndig mann se þe lufige þisses galdres begang þæt he geoce me ond frofre fricle ic sceall feor heonan an elles forþ eardes neosan siþ asettan nat ic sylfa hwær of þisse worulde wic sindon uncuþ eard ond eþel swa biþ ælcum menn nemþe he godcundes gastes bruce ah utu we þe geornor to gode cleopigan sendan usse bene on þa beorhtan gesceaft þæt we þæs botles brucan motan hames in hehþo þær is hihta mæst þær cyning engla clænum gildeþ lean unhwilen nu a his lof standeþ mycel ond mære ond his miht seomaþ ece ond edgiong ofer ealle gesceaft [finit]
